An innovative way of working
At Sqills, teams have a lot of freedom in choosing the languages and tools they work with. We currently use a mix of modern technologies, including Java, and work in a cloud-based environment using AWS.
We build and manage our infrastructure as code and develop a combination of microservices and serverless solutions. This allows us to create scalable, flexible systems that support our international platform.
We place strong emphasis on monitoring and reliability. Our teams use modern monitoring tools and our own platform to gain insights into system performance and quickly detect and resolve issues within our microservice landscape.
Secure development, strong architecture, performance, and resiliency are the pillars of our development process. This ensures our software continues to meet and exceed expectations in the future.
What will you do?
You will be part of one of the Agile DevOps teams. Teams consist of a combination of Developers, Testers and a Product Owner. As a team, you are responsible for the complete development and management cycle.
Together you work on (backend) microservices in the AWS Cloud. Because you work with software that handles hundreds of requests per second (high performance), your work continues to be challenging.
Some of the things you are responsible for include:
Designing and implementing microservices for S3 Passenger;
Translating functionalities into software solutions and bridging the gap between desired functionality and technical solution;
At Sqills we focus on quality. This is reflected in the ownership our team members have for their own microservices, but also in the fact we have extensive requirements for developing components.
Because our software offers the complete inventory, reservation and ticketing suite for our international customers, our focus on quality is especially important.
